Q reviewed by Monitor magazine

Our top tech magazine reviewed the Q and K-01 (check respective forum). Here's for the Q:

Scores:
Image Quality 3/10
Design, build quality etc. 6/10

Pros: Size, weight, "Toy Lens" prices, functionality vs. size, in-built ND filter in "Standard" lenses

Cons: Sensor size and noise, lack of AF and aperture control in the "Toy" lenses, lack of 200mm+ equivalent native lens.

Quick summary: You need to take comments about the sensor with a grain of salt, since they wrote that it's on par with the best compacts. They mentioned the low price and expandability, full manual control and external control along with a great design, handling and build quality.

I picked up a Q for $450 but returned the following day. While it is an exceptionally fun and fascinating camera, I found the LCD to be practically useless in day light; which is too bad, because I really enjoyed the camera otherwise.

Without debating the reviewer's assessment of the quality of the sensor or JHD's experiences leading him/her to return the camera so quickly, I have found the Q to be a joy to use and am very happy with the images it produces. Yeah, it's a small sensor. But it does amazing things with that small sensor. And yeah, you can hardly see the display in bright sun (sadly common with many cameras). So I use an external viewfinder in that situation. Overall, for the record, I'm a happy camper with my lil' Q. Just wishing Pentax would hurry up and release those lenses on their roadmap.
